Ability to return sub-components of a Profile from Source Control
Currently, profiles in source control are stored with everything as it's all stored in a single file (apex class permissions, layout assignments, etc). This is done by Salesforce.
When using the new "delta deploy" or any comparison that doesn't include every possible dependent component (ex. apex, layouts, etc) - you see many "new" or "deleted" items related to the fact that source control returns everything within the profile whereas Salesforce only returns specific permissions based on the retrieved components.
It'd be great if Gearset could replicate this behavior with source control to match Salesforce's behavior, where it'll obviously have to…

Modify files during deployment process
In Salesforce, if you add an image to a PathAssistant, it hard codes the sandbox URL in the metadata. This causes failures when you then try to deploy that item to the next environment. My idea is that a feature is added that would allow some sort of find/replace logic that's applied prior to the CI compare. Something like:
File: Enter the name of the package file
Search Text: The text and/or regex string to search the file for
Replacement Text: The text to replace found the text withIn this way, it would modify the source file prior to…

Inline Editing of metadata
Inline Editing of metadata
In order to make our deployment successful we had to download the package, modify the version numbers on the flow definitions, and then compare the local package to the target org. It would be very helpful if we can edit the metadata XML in the UI so we can fix the version numbers.99 votesHello. A large number of commenters requested the ability to carry out value replacements as part of metadata deployments.
Gearset now offers a feature called Environment Variables that lets you do just that!
It works with both manual and CI deployments and lets you target either a Salesforce org or a Git repo of your choice. And, for a number of key metadata types, you can even specify the exact 'field' where the replacement should take place.
If you have any feedback on the Environment Variables feature, please open a new feature request or simply let us know in the in-app chat.
Thank you for upvoting this feature request and we hope that you will find the Environment Variables feature useful.
